I would like to have Authlib 0.11 to return oauth tokens as JWT. I tried to follow the documentation provided in Authlib website to create a JWT token generator with Authlib 0.11 https://docs.authlib.org/en/latest/flask/2/authorization-server.html#token.
Since, I am a novice user in this topic I still couldn't figure out the right way to pass my JWT token generator method to the config:OAUTH2_ACCESS_TOKEN_GENERATOR
Any help is appreciated.
Here is my dummy jwt token generator:
from authlib.jose import jwt
def gen_access_token(client, grant_type, user, scope):
log.debug('Not used yet in the JWT:: {} \n{} \n{} \n{}'.format( client, grant_type, user, scope))
header = {'alg': 'RS256'}
payload = {
'iss': 'http://127.0.0.1:5000/oauth/token',
'sub': 'test client',
'aud': 'profile'
}
try:
key = open('wf-app-server.key', 'r').read()
s = jwt.encode(header, payload, key)
claims = jwt.decode(s, open('wf-app-pub.pem', 'r').read())
except Exception as e:
log.debug('JWT exception', e)
log.debug("jwt encoded:{}\n decoded :{} \n header:{}".format(
s, claims, claims.header))
return s
